Home Information Packs
If you intend to sell your home, you are legally obliged to have a Home Information Pack (HIP) commissioned before it goes on the market.
At Grange Wintringham our conveyancers will prepare your HIP efficiently and as cost effectively as possible. We are familiar with obtaining all the usual information required when dealing with residential properties and have the technical facilities to obtain much of the information immediately. We will arrange for a local agent to prepare the Energy Performance Certificate.
The cost of a basic HIP i.e. for a simple freehold sale of a property registered at the Land Registry is £299 inclusive of VAT. For a leasehold property the cost will be higher to reflect the additional documents required.
